Transaction 65473d0e17c3b0faa51982543ca2ebec5bb3778765a26c58c62cc7a49f7a836f
1 Input
1 Output
-
65473d0e17c3b0faa51982543ca2ebec5bb3778765a26c58c62cc7a49f7a836f:0
- value
- 503011
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ebcafa81d8d678aae779cde26690a1fba8b4b40c OP_EQUAL
- address
- 3PBmspXz44ryx73zcNBKh2AKLyfvFjXmeD